We process personal data only for the following purposes and legal bases:

  • Technical logs and theme preference: our legitimate interest in maintaining a secure, functional, and user‑friendly Website (Art. 31 para. 2 FADP; Art. 6(1)(f) GDPR where applicable).
  • Analytics via Mixpanel: your explicit consent (Art. 31 para. 1 FADP; Art. 6(1)(a) GDPR).
  • Responding to contact form inquiries: steps taken at your request prior to entering into a contract or our legitimate interest in communicating with you (Art. 31 para. 2 FADP; Art. 6(1)(b) or (f) GDPR where applicable).

We do not use your personal data for marketing, profiling, automated decision‑making, or any other unrelated purposes.

7. Your Rights

Under applicable data protection laws, you have the following rights regarding your personal data:

  • Right of access
  • Right to rectification
  • Right to erasure (“right to be forgotten”)
  • Right to restriction of processing
  • Right to object
  • Right to data portability (where applicable under GDPR)
  • Right to withdraw consent at any time (without affecting the lawfulness of processing prior to withdrawal)

To exercise these rights, please contact us using the details in Section 1. We will respond without undue delay and free of charge (unless requests are manifestly unfounded or excessive).

You also have the right to lodge a complaint with the Swiss Federal Data Protection and Information Commissioner (FDPIC) or, if GDPR applies, with your local supervisory authority.
